Confrontation and Cooperation: Germany and the United States in the Era of World War I, 19-1924 - Krefeld Historical Symposia Hans-jurgen Schroder
Confrontation and Cooperation: Germany and the United States in the Era of World War I, 19-1924 - Krefeld Historical Symposia
Hans-jurgen Schroder
This volume represents a comprehensive analysis, by experts on both sides of the Atlantic, of how and why Germany and the United States found themeselves at war against each other in 1917, and how the end of their confrontation paved the way for an era of renewed co-operation.
